Greene, Murray A. was born on May 20, 1927 in Brooklyn. Son of Max and Beatrice (Kolomer) Greene.
AB, New York University, 1948; Doctor of Medicine, Columbia University, 1952.
Intern, Maimonides Hospital, Brooklyn, 1952-1953; assistant resident in medicine, Maimonides Hospital, 1953-1954; research fellow cardiopulmonary laboratory, Maimonides Hospital and State University of New York Downstate Medical Center, 1954-1955, 56-57; resident in medicine, Montefiore Hospital, New York City, 1955-1956; chief division cardiovascular diseases, director intensive care unit and cardiopulmonary laboratory, Bronx-Lebanon Hospital, New York City, 1957-1971; attending physician department medicine, Bronx-Lebanon Hospital, New York City, since 1957; assistant clinical professor medicine, Albert Einstein College Medicine, New York City, since 1972.
Served with United States Army, 1945-1947. Fellow American College of Physicians, American College Chest Physicians, American Federation Clinical Research. Member American Medical Association, American Physicians Fellowship assosiation, New York Academy Sciences, American Heart assosiation, New York Heart Association, American Society Internal Medicine, New York Society Internal Medicine, Medical Society State New York, Phi Beta Kappa.
Married Eileen Smolkin, December 19, 1953. Children: Barry T., Larry B.
